Tendências DevSecOps: O Futuro do Cloud-Native

A evolução do DevSecOps está redefinindo os paradigmas de segurança no desenvolvimento de software. Segundo o relatório "DevSecOps in the Cloud" da Deloitte, 2024 marca um ponto de virada na maturidade dessas práticas, com organizações movendo-se além da simples integração de segurança para abordagens mais sofisticadas e automatizadas.

Tendências Emergentes no DevSecOps

1. Segurança como Código (SaC)

A codificação da segurança está se tornando o novo padrão, com organizações:

  • Implementando políticas de segurança via Infrastructure as Code (IaC)

  • Automatizando configurações de segurança através de templates

  • Utilizando frameworks de compliance como código

  • Integrando controles de segurança diretamente nos pipelines CI/CD

2. IA/ML na Segurança Automatizada

A inteligência artificial está revolucionando o DevSecOps através de:

  • Detecção predictiva de vulnerabilidades

  • Análise comportamental para identificação de ameaças

  • Automação de respostas a incidentes

  • Otimização dinâmica de políticas de segurança

3. Zero Trust DevSecOps

A integração de princípios Zero Trust está se tornando fundamental:

  • Verificação contínua de identidade em todo o pipeline

  • Microsegmentação de ambientes de desenvolvimento

  • Autenticação e autorização granular para cada componente

  • Monitoramento contínuo de comportamentos suspeitos

Inovações Tecnológicas Impactantes

Cloud-Native Security

  • Adoption de service mesh para segurança de microserviços

  • Implementação de políticas de segurança via Kubernetes

  • Uso de CNAPP (Cloud-Native Application Protection Platform)

  • Securição de containers em runtime

Automação Avançada

  • Orquestração de segurança multi-cloud

  • Remediação automática de vulnerabilidades

  • Gestão automatizada de secrets

  • Continuous Compliance Monitoring

Métricas e KPIs Evolutivos

Indicadores Modernos de Sucesso

  1. MTTR (Mean Time to Remediate) automatizado

  2. Taxa de vulnerabilidades em produção

  3. Cobertura de segurança automatizada

  4. Tempo de detecção de ameaças

Benchmark de Maturidade

  • Níveis de automação de segurança

  • Integração de ferramentas de segurança

  • Cobertura de testes de segurança

  • Eficácia da resposta a incidentes

Desafios e Soluções Emergentes

Complexidade Multi-Cloud

Desafio: Manter consistência de segurança entre diferentes clouds Solução: Implementação de frameworks de política unificada e ferramentas de orquestração cross-cloud

Escala e Performance

Desafio: Manter velocidade com segurança aumentada Solução: Uso de técnicas de paralelização e otimização de pipelines

O Futuro do DevSecOps

Tendências para Observar

  1. Shift-Everything-Left

    • Testes de segurança ainda mais precoces

    • Validação de configurações pré-deployment

    • Análise de dependências em tempo de desenvolvimento

  2. Security Mesh Architecture

    • Segurança distribuída e adaptativa

    • Políticas baseadas em contexto

    • Proteção integrada de endpoints

  3. GitOps para Segurança

    • Versionamento de políticas de segurança

    • Automação baseada em repositórios

    • Auditoria completa de mudanças

O DevSecOps está evoluindo rapidamente de uma metodologia de integração de segurança para uma abordagem holística de segurança cloud-native. As organizações que conseguirem adotar estas tendências emergentes e automatizar efetivamente seus controles de segurança estarão melhor posicionadas para enfrentar os desafios de segurança do desenvolvimento moderno.

O foco agora deve estar na implementação de soluções mais inteligentes e automatizadas, permitindo que as equipes de desenvolvimento mantenham a velocidade enquanto garantem a segurança em cada etapa do processo. A chave para o sucesso está na adoção estratégica dessas tendências emergentes e na construção de uma cultura que valorize tanto a inovação quanto a segurança.